Abstract
This paper deals with the variation of MIMO channel capacity, channel correlation and impact on BER in a close loop system (CSI at transmitter). Simulation studies shows that relative to open loop system (CSI not at transmitter) and i.i.d channel conditions, the channel capacity of a close loop system reduces, as Eo/No increases. The consequence is that, it has deteriorating impact on the BER of the system. Moreover, as channel correlation becomes more pronounced with increasing Eo/No, we see significant effects at higher Eo/No than lower Eo/No points in terms of channel capacity and BER in a close loop MIMO system.
